The spin 3 2 Ising model on a two layer Bethe lattice with AFM AFM interactions

Abstract The spin‐3/2 Ising model is studied on a two‐layer Bethe lattice with antiferromagnetic/antiferromagnetic (AFM/AFM) intralayer and either FM or AFM type of interlayer interactions by using the pairwise approach for the coordination numbers q = 3, 4, and 6. In the guidance of the ground‐state phase diagrams, the thermal variations of the magnetizations, susceptibility and specific heat are examined in detail to obtain the critical behaviors of the model. Thus, it was found that the model presents second‐ and first‐order phase transitions; where their lines are combined is a tricritical point. In addition, the model also presents two Néel temperatures, the existence of which leads to the re‐entrant behavior.
